The Wera 5056440001 BC Universal Rapidaptor Bit-Check is a premium 30-piece bit set featuring a quick-release universal bit holder for rapid one-handed bit changes. Its torsion bits are designed to prevent premature wear, ensuring long-lasting performance. Housed in a durable, ultra-slim plastic case that fits easily in a shirt pocket, this versatile set covers all major drive types including Slotted, Torx, Hex, Phillips, and Pozidriv. Made in the Czech Republic, it’s the perfect blend of precision engineering and everyday convenience for professionals on the go.

Perfect Bit Holder - Excellent Bits
This is the best set of bits that I have found next to the $3/each Snap-on bits.Pros:These bits are precision machined and very hard. They are durable enough that I have not been able to strip one while using them in an 18-volt powered driver. They are not designed for use with an impact driver, but Wera does make a set that is. The shank on these bits is machined down to provide a torque-limiting effect, which does two things: (1) It limits the torque the bit experiences at the fastener, keeping it from reaching the point where it strips out. (2) The narrow shank provides enough clearance that you can reach recessed fasteners, which is especially helpful in dismantling electronics or driving shallow countersunk screws. The bit holder for this set is a masterpiece. It holds 30 bits and a chuck, and yet it could easily fit in a pocket. The lid flips back and stands the bit holder up at a 45-degree angle, and the back row of bits flips back about 25 degrees to allow enough clearance to easily access the bits you need. The bits slide in and out fairly easily, but do not fall out if the bit holder is dropped while it is open (the lid might pop off, but it easily slips back on). The bit chuck that comes with this set is built very well and allows you to easily exchange bits without loosening the chuck on your driver.Cons:The bit chuck included with this set is very short and I would find it to be more useful if it were longer.Caveats:First off, this isn't a con, but a caveat emptor; this set is apparently designed for use in Europe. The slotted bit included in the set is a 1-mm bit, and it contains six Pozidriv bits, none of which have I found to be very often useful in the US (although Pozidriv is generally superior to Phillips, which is designed to cam out of the fastener at high torque load). As to the review in which the user experienced corrosion on the surface of the bits, all I can say is that I have had no such problems with my bits. If I was to guess, I would say the customer perhaps stored the tools too close to corrosives such as muriatic acid or pool chlorine, or lived in an area with high humidity and did not properly protect the tools. Tool steel is very susceptible to corrosion, and I wipe my non-chromed tools down with machine oil and store them far away from potential corrosives. Anyway, please don't let one bad review prevent you from trying out these awesome bits.2-Year Update:I have been using these bits for over 2 years now and I have yet to wear any of them out. They are used primarily for automotive work and some odd tasks around the house. I have used them in an 18-volt impact driver, but they see most of their use in a Williams T-handle ratcheting screwdriver. I still have not experienced any problems with rust, but I am good about keeping my tools clean, dry, and oiled. At this point, I have no issues recommending this set and will buy another one when this one wears out.
